The Golden Calf 2011-02-19 This is the 'head' of a large piece of art labelled "The Golden Calf - Technology as Apocalypse" from Karl Anton Wolf in 1986. It is one of three figures. In stands in the Donaupark in Vienna's 22nd district. Belvedere 2011-02-09 The view from the Lower Belveder to the Upper Belveder palais in Vienna at sunset. It *is* still February, so nothing is growing and the gardeners have protected the flower beds for the winter. The Upper palace contains the Klimt/Schiele/etc collection. The Lower palace (which is also behind me) has rotating exhibitions - the Rodin exhibition just closed.
